100 union members earn degrees
at CNR
More than 100 brand new college graduates
beamed with pride in their shiny robes as they approached the stage
at DC 37 May 5 to receive their baccalaureate degrees.
Equally proud were the families, friends and co-workers of the new grads
who attended the Eighth Annual Hooding Ceremony of the College of New
Rochelles DC 37 Campus. The ceremony is named for the academic
headgear that graduates have earned the right to wear since medieval
times.
Almost 3,000 DC 37 members have graduated from the union campus
the only one of its kind at any union which is part of CNRs
School of New Resources.
